NaNoWriMo: Eroding

The waves rush in,
Caressing the sand
With soft, tender touches.
The tide whispers
Gentle, sly words
Of love.
Gently tugging,
It draws away,
Leaving scars
Rutted into the beach,
Marring the beauty
It so desired before.

The tide rises,
Falls,
Rises.
Wearing away
The soft sand
Beneath my feet.
Stealing a few grains
With each teasing touch.
Leaving behind nothing,
Only taking, destroying.

My shore
Slowly disappears
Beneath my feet.
Never to reappear.
Salty tears of the sea
Remind me of what was
Once my beautiful beach.
